Activities and local experiences around Navis
Navis is surrounded by outdoor opportunities that are ideal for a group of friends who want to stay active and have fun. In summer, the area offers a network of hiking trails suited to different fitness levels—from gentle forest walks to more challenging alpine routes with rewarding panoramas. Many routes start at or near Navis, winding through pine forests and along ridgelines where you can catch views of the Inn Valley expanding below you. For the more adventurous, nearby Innsbruck and the broader Tirol region offer via ferrata routes, mountain biking tracks, and climbing areas that test skill while delivering the best photos of the alpine scenery.
In winter, the Tirol Alps transform into a winter playground. You can enjoy easy-access snowshoeing, cross-country skiing on scenic trails, and day trips to nearby ski resorts. The Nordkette cable car from Innsbruck can be a gateway to high-alpine adventures with stunning city views, making it possible to mix a city day with a deep mountain experience. Getting there and moving around Navis
Most travelers arrive in Tirol via Innsbruck, whether by flight into Innsbruck Airport or by rail. From Innsbruck, a short drive or bus ride takes you into Navis and the surrounding Innsbruck-Land area. If you’re renting a car, you’ll appreciate the easy access to scenic drives that link Navis to Hall in Tirol, Wattens, and the Tyrolean Alps. For non-drivers, regional buses connect Navis with Innsbruck and nearby towns on a reliable schedule, making a Room Only vacation rental in Navis a practical choice for a group that wants to mix day trips with days spent exploring the village itself.
